About the Program

The Master in Engineering In Applied Materials is a one-year program for students who have a Bachelor's degree and want to gain expertise in material characterisation, design, and selection. This Master's degree is offered by South East Technological University in Ireland. The main advantage of this program is that it provides learners with the tools and techniques essential for a career in engineering.

The curriculum includes subjects like Materials Science in Engineering, Finite Element Analysis, and Applied Mechanics of Materials. Students will also develop skills in design, innovation, and research methods. The program has hands-on components, such as a work-based project and a dissertation, which help students apply their knowledge in real-world settings.

Graduates of this program can pursue careers as Materials Engineers, Research and Development Managers, Quality Control Engineers, or Design Engineers. They can work in industries like manufacturing, aerospace, or automotive, and can be employed by companies like Intel, Siemens, or Rolls-Royce.
